Diabetes Resource Nurse
CaroMont Health Gastonia, NC
Job Summary:      The DRN role is a non-24/7 nursing role, that crosses all continuum of health care sites functioning in the role of expert clinician, educator, and nurse care manager for diabetes patients across the continuum of care.  In collaboration with the medical and ancillary staff, monitors the clinical care of patients and provides clinical support to improve patient care and outcomes, for both inpatient, outpatient, and across the continuum of care. Provides a significant level of disease-specific education to patient and hospital staff. Participates in ass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ating health services of a disease specific population during hospitalization, post discharge, and site of service across the continuum. Performs tasks requiring independent knowledge and judgment. Implements performance improvement initiatives. Provides community outreach activities.
